Why is "prioritization" of vulnerabilities something every system administrator should think about during vulnerability scanning?

a) To make the scanning process faster.
b) To impress the management with a long list of vulnerabilities.
c) To focus resources on fixing the most critical issues first.
d) To create confusion among the security team.

Final answer:

Prioritizing vulnerabilities allows system administrators to focus resources on fixing the most critical issues first.

Step-by-step explanation:

The prioritization of vulnerabilities during vulnerability scanning is important for every system administrator because it allows them to focus resources on fixing the most critical issues first. This ensures that the most severe vulnerabilities are addressed promptly, reducing the risk of exploitation and potential damage to the system. It also helps in allocating the limited resources efficiently, as fixing all vulnerabilities might not be feasible or necessary.
